Two people were killed after a drunk driver in a speeding Porsche knocked down them at Banjara Hills Road no 2 in the early hours of Monday. As per the police records, the two victims Tribhuvan Rai and Debendra Kumar Das, both working for a corporate hospital as an office boy and assistant cook respectively died on the spot.
The victims were returning home after completing work. As they were crossing the road, the Porsche, which was coming from Nagarjuna Circle and heading towards KBR park, hit them at high speed. The victims hit flung into the air, landed on-road and breathed their last. The bodies were sent to Osmania General Hospital for autopsy and a probe was initiated.
The youth, who was driving the vehicle, parked it in an apartment in Jubilee Hills. He later surrendered before the police and was identified as Rohit Goud, a realtor. He was accompanied by his friend Suman, seated next to him. The police sent the duo for an alcohol test to ascertain if they were in an inebriated condition at the time of the accident.
